Continuous Data Protection (CDP) is where changed files
are backed up and saved for later restorations. With our CDP backup system, you can restore up to 15 different
restore points -- that is 15 days worth of backups.
Most backups are taken once a day while some, like databases, may be taken more often to give the best protection.
Also, users are able to restore their backups of mail, linux websites, and MySQL databases on their own without our
intervention.
Customers can also restore backups for Linux websites, mailboxes, and MySQL/PGSQL databases. Currently
Windows websites and MSSQL databases can't be restored by customers -- Windows accounts using mail and MySQL resources
can still be restored by customers.
